I'm not an expert on the whole exercise thing but I think that if you are just sticking to cardio workouts, you are not really reshaping your body - that only comes with weight training. You don't have to pump tonnes of weight either. You can start with a pair of 5 lbs hand weights and do some squats, bench presses, rows, side laterals, curls and tricep extensions (to see how these exercises look check out fatwars.com). You can do 2-3 sets of 20 reps per exercise and if you do incorporate the weights into your workout do the weights FIRST, then do a 30-60 min cardio workout. Of course before you do anything at the gym start your entire workout with 10 minutes of moderate cardio to get your body going, then the weights, then the rest of the cardio at your fat-burning rate.
So far this has worked for me. I haven't lost any inches in my bust or waist (which traditionally were the first places I'd lose) but I have lost some inches off my stomach, hips and thigh area which is where I want the majority of weight to come off so I am a happy camper.
